My brother and I dont seem to have a problem finding grass, its findind the dolphin. We run out of Oregon Inlet anywhere from 15-38 miles. Does anyone have any trolling tips or techniques on how to hook up with the dolphin? We usually troll Drone spoons and Sea Witches with Ballyhoo or cut bait at about 1000rpms or about 5 kts.

I would pick up the speed a little to about 7 and i allways like to have 2 skipping baits either bally's or bonito bellys with skirts.they always seam to like them for me.
